"Inductions and Deepeners: Styles and Approaches for Effective Hypnosis" by Richard K. Nongard provides both the new and experienced hypnotist with a reference book of actual hypnotic session scripts in a variety of styles, for work with both adults and children. These hypnosis scripts - from creative adaptations of Milton Erickson's Levitation, Dave Elman's Count with Amnesia, and Zarren's Marble induction approaches, to Nongard's own unique "Eyes-Open Backwards Hypnosis" "superconscious" strategy - offer useful demonstrations and detailed explanations for real success. Learn to combine approaches for enhanced trance depth; understand hypnotic language patterns; increase your confidence and abilities; zoom past the Critical Factor into the Subconscious with Rapid Touch inductions; and experience suggestion compliance with even the most fidgety child. Most of the variables suggestive of hypnotic responsiveness in the adult have their precursors in the creative, affective, and play experiences of youngsters. This remarkable book explores the fascinating gifts of imagery and natural trance that seem almost organic to childhood ? and their immense therapeutic potential. Sixteen specialists describe in lucid, accessible terms the current state of their diverse clinical work and thinking: theoretical foundations; assessments of the presenting problems, associated etiologies, and corresponding approaches; the intervention process; and future trends in treatment. Among the topics covered are hypnotic strategies for different developmental stages; treatment for a variety of habit disorders; treatment of childhood traumas, motor and vocal tics, somatoform disorders, and learning disorders; and the use of hypnosis for the management of chronic nausea and vomiting and acute and chronic pain.
